KU KLUX.

THE “IMPERIAL WIZARD.” Mr Edward Price Bell tells in the April Landmark, the magazine of the English-speaking I nion, of a conversation that recently took place at the Hotel Lincoln, Indianapolis, between himself and Dr. H. W. Evans, the “Imperial Wizard" of the Ku Klux Klan. “Will you explain the dress and the strange-sounding names of the Klan?” “What Government, what Church what secret order, what fraternity of any kind, is without its characterising forms? Surely pomp and circumstance, ceremonial, ritual, formulary, were not unknown in the world prior to the organisation of native-born white American Protestants, bent upon salving American traditions from the mongrelised and criminalised foreign deluge? Our mask, about which so many persons appear to vex their wits barrenly, has two substantial functions; it protects scores of thousands of our members from intimidation, sabotage, and worse; and it screens our leaders from the temptation to forget the general interest in the pursuit of particular whims or ambitions. When our speakers face their audiences, they arc masked. Self-esteem is eliminated. There is no lure of personal vanity, nor of demagogy. Out of the speakers’ mouths issue only those things which in their hearts they feel are true, unselfish, and patriotic. How many of the popular statesmen of the day would like to pour forth their messages from behind masks? It is labour, with only one reward—though, as true values go, the best reward — the solace of duty done.” •What is the answer to the argu ment that the nation cannot exist half Klan and half anti-Klan?”

“It is never going to be half Klan and half anti-Klan. It will be either predominantly Klan, or the victim of those heterogeneous un-American elements which neither understand nor are able to execute the characteristic political and social inspiration of the founders of this country. Ku Kluxism, by whatever name it is called, is the sine qua non of the fruition of the American principle of organised society."

“Do jou mind explaining the oath?”

“Certainly not. It is as categoric and solemn as the English language, can make it. It enjoins obedience to the order's constitution, laws, regulations, usages, and requirements; and prescribes the strictest secrecy regarding its internal affairs Each member swears he ‘never will recom mend for membership any person whose mind is unsound, whoso reputation is bad, whose ' character is doubtful, or whose loyalty to the United states of America is in any way questionable. Selfishness of every form is interdicted. Social loyalty is elevated above personal friendship, blood relationship, family interest, and every other relatively narrow tie. Klansmansbip is stringently enjoined, but only ‘in all things honourable. ’ To the Government of the United States, and to the Govern ments of the States of the Union, vic ‘sacredly swear unqualified allegiance’ pledging our property, our votes, our honour, and our lives. Free education, free speech, free press, separation of Church and State, white supremacy, just laws, the pursuit of happiness—all these each Klansman swears to seal with his blood,, ‘be Thou my witness, Almighty God.’ ”

“Then the Klan is oath-bound to refrain from, and to oppose, mob violence?”

“Yes. Every Klansman who coin mits a lawless act, or who withholds his influence against such an act, at the same time commits perjury. Uninformed and malicious critics have accused us of being a whipping organisation. Many crimes and cruelties abhorrent to our every feeling, conviction, and purpose have been charged against our order caluminiously. If we were a whipping organisation, with our hundreds of thousands of ardent members spread throughout the country, and with insolent breakers of every law, human and divine, abounding, we should be whipping thousands of culprits every night. They deserve it. But that is not the Klan way. Our way is to put the right men into office, and to build up a public sentiment that will not only encourage, but compel, them to do their duty in conformity with their oaths. Far from instigating mob violence the klan is reducing it. Lynchings are much fewer than they were before the Klan became powerful. Statistics this year will prove this, and will show the areas of great Klan strength as freest from anarchic outbreaks of every kind. Klan power means power of law enforcement. I invite you to point out a single bootlegger, hi jacker, blackleg, gambler, den-keeper,, roue, crook, Bolshevist, anarchist, demagogue, political hypocrite, or scoundrel who likes the Klan. All this mottled horde is against us, and will be against us to the finish. Is it not about time out decent critics began to love us for some of the enemies we have made?”

“Your Christianity has been impugned because of your exclusivism.” “Klansmen stand on the Holy Bible. Upon the Holy Bible rest the American Constitution and American civilisation. Klansmen are wholeheartedly Christian, implacably opposed to atheistic intellectualism, and to all the amatory and erotic tendencies of modern degeneracy. We are Christian, but we have no monopoly of Christianity. God is love. Would that all men knew Him! In the whole structure of its thought and policy, Klan quality is Christian quality. Its opposition, wherever it opposes, is for the purpose,, not of injuring, but of helping.”

“What is your idea of American foreign policy?” ‘‘lt should be, in my judgment, a policy of the greatest energy, sympathy, and courage—a Christian policy, sagacious and self-respecting, but not too self-regarding, and certainly not sordid. What the world needs above all else, is the measureless boon of peace. Physical courage will not bring peace. Peace will come only through a resolute exercise of mental and moral force—through clear thinking and vigorous pleading. Our voice should be heard in the council rooms of humanity.”
